Sciatica is a term that describes pain that radiates along the path of the sciatic nerve, which extends from the lower back through the pelvis and down each leg. This condition can be uncomfortable and debilitating, causing you to lose mobility or get tired quickly. Causes of Sciatica
The causes of sciatica can vary, but they often stem from issues in the spine. Common culprits include herniated discs, spinal stenosis, and degenerative disc disease. These conditions can lead to nerve compression, resulting in pain, tingling, or numbness that travels along the sciatic nerve. Symptoms to Watch For
The most common symptom of sciatica is a sharp, shooting pain that can make it difficult to sit, stand, or walk comfortably. Some people may also experience a burning sensation, muscle weakness, or difficulty moving the affected leg.
